Nobody Told Me: Poetry and Parenthood
by Hollie McNish
I love Hollie McNish's poetry – nobody talks more honestly or more humanly about being a mother, and her poetry blends the personal and the political nicely. That said, this book falls apart because the prose drags, the political commentary isn't saying anything new to her (predominantly left-wing) audience, and is just less interesting than the poetry.
